New Ordinance Bans Firearms at Parades

The Jackson City Council has enacted an ordinance prohibiting firearms at parades within the city limits. This measure aims to enhance public safety during large gatherings.

Hal’s St. Paddy’s Parade Route Adjusted

Organizers of the annual Hal’s St. Paddy’s Parade have announced changes to the parade route for the upcoming event on March 28, 2026. The parade will now start at Court and West Streets and conclude at State and Court streets. This adjustment is intended to provide better access for police and security personnel when needed. The parade will begin an hour earlier this year, at noon instead of 1 p.m.

Governor Declares State of Emergency Due to Winter Storm

Governor Tate Reeves has declared a state of emergency in response to severe winter weather impacting Mississippi. The declaration allows for the mobilization of state resources to support affected counties. Residents are advised to prepare for potential power outages and to stay informed through official channels.

Winter Storm Claims 14 Lives Statewide

The severe winter storm has resulted in 14 fatalities across Mississippi. The Mississippi Emergency Management Agency (MEMA) reports significant damage, including 223 homes, 10 businesses, and seven farms affected. Additionally, 20 public roads have sustained major damage, with 12 destroyed. Recovery efforts are ongoing, and residents are urged to exercise caution during the recovery period.
